Our School-Based TeleBehavioral Health Program uses the latest health care technology to connect your child with the care they need to manage stress and emotions.
Many children and teens struggle with stress and emotional situations, which often take place at school. Our School-Based Telebehavioral Health Program helps school counselors support children’s mental and emotional health needs.
Since launching in schools in 2017, we have provided access to school-based telebehavioral health services to over 100,000 students in 200+ schools. Each year, we perform over 1,000 virtual therapy sessions.

Program Success
Since our School-Based TeleBehavioral Health Program started in 2017, we've:
- Provided access to School-Based TeleBehavioral Health services to nearly 218,000 students
- Expanded into 250 campuses within 34 school districts
- Performed over 5,200 behavioral health virtual visits
- Conducted over 11,600 telephonic case management contacts
